Subject: [PATCH] mfd: da9052: Fix genirq abuse

Rather than using the pointer passed back by the regmap API (or complaining
because that wasn't actually being set) the da9052 driver was having some
fun and games peering through genirq and regmap internals. Fix the driver
to use the API as expected.

Signed-off-by: Mark Brown <broonie@...nsource.wolfsonmicro.com>
---
 drivers/mfd/da9052-core.c         |    8 +++-----
 include/linux/mfd/da9052/da9052.h |    1 +
 2 files changed, 4 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/mfd/da9052-core.c b/drivers/mfd/da9052-core.c
index 7ff313f..7776aff 100644
--- a/drivers/mfd/da9052-core.c
+++ b/drivers/mfd/da9052-core.c
@@ -659,12 +659,11 @@ int __devinit da9052_device_init(struct da9052 *da9052, u8 chip_id)
 	ret = regmap_add_irq_chip(da9052->regmap, da9052->chip_irq,
 				  IRQF_TRIGGER_LOW | IRQF_ONESHOT,
 				  da9052->irq_base, &da9052_regmap_irq_chip,
-				  NULL);
+				  &da9052->irq_data);
 	if (ret < 0)
 		goto regmap_err;
 
-	desc = irq_to_desc(da9052->chip_irq);
-	da9052->irq_base = regmap_irq_chip_get_base(desc->action->dev_id);
+	da9052->irq_base = regmap_irq_chip_get_base(da9052->irq_data);
 
 	ret = mfd_add_devices(da9052->dev, -1, da9052_subdev_info,
 			      ARRAY_SIZE(da9052_subdev_info), NULL, 0);
@@ -681,8 +680,7 @@ regmap_err:
 
 void da9052_device_exit(struct da9052 *da9052)
 {
-	regmap_del_irq_chip(da9052->chip_irq,
-			    irq_get_irq_data(da9052->irq_base)->chip_data);
+	regmap_del_irq_chip(da9052->chip_irq, da9052->irq_data);
 	mfd_remove_devices(da9052->dev);
 }
 
diff --git a/include/linux/mfd/da9052/da9052.h b/include/linux/mfd/da9052/da9052.h
index 7ffbd6e..8313cd9 100644
--- a/include/linux/mfd/da9052/da9052.h
+++ b/include/linux/mfd/da9052/da9052.h
@@ -80,6 +80,7 @@ struct da9052 {
 	struct regmap *regmap;
 
 	int irq_base;
+	struct regmap_irq_chip_data *irq_data;
 	u8 chip_id;
 
 	int chip_irq;
